在信息技術飛速發展的今天,掌握全棧開發能力已成為許多開發者和學生的追求。由邢益良等編著的《PHP Web和Android開發入門與實踐》一書,作為高等院校信息技術規劃教材,恰好為讀者提供了一個從Web后端到移動前端的連貫學習路徑。本書不僅系統性地介紹了PHP Web開發與Android開發的核心技術,更注重二者的結合與實踐,旨在培養能夠應對多平臺開發需求的復合型人才。
一、內容體系:從基礎到實踐,脈絡清晰
本書結構設計合理,循序漸進。前半部分聚焦于PHP Web開發,詳細講解了PHP語言基礎、MySQL數據庫操作、面向對象編程、MVC設計模式,以及使用主流框架(如ThinkPHP)進行快速開發的技巧。內容從環境搭建開始,逐步深入到會話管理、文件上傳、安全防護等實戰主題,確保讀者能夠構建功能完整的動態網站。
后半部分則轉向Android移動開發,覆蓋了Android Studio開發環境、Activity生命周期、UI設計、數據存儲、網絡通信等核心知識。尤為突出的是,本書特意設計了如何讓Android前端與PHP后端進行數據交互的章節,例如通過HTTP協議調用API接口、解析JSON數據等,實現了Web服務與移動應用的有效聯通。這種安排打破了傳統教材中Web與移動開發割裂的局限,幫助讀者理解現代應用開發中前后端分離與協作的全貌。
二、特色亮點:注重實踐,案例驅動
作為一本入門與實踐并重的教材,本書的最大特色在于其強烈的實踐導向。每個重要知識點都配有可運行的代碼示例,且章節末尾設有綜合性的實訓項目。例如,在Web部分,讀者可以跟隨教程一步步開發一個簡易的新聞發布系統;在Android部分,則可能實現一個與之配套的新聞閱讀客戶端。這種項目驅動的學習方式,不僅能鞏固理論知識,更能讓讀者在動手過程中積累寶貴的項目經驗,理解從需求分析到部署上線的完整流程。
書中對開發中常見的“坑”和最佳實踐給予了提示,這對于初學者規避錯誤、養成良好的編程習慣大有裨益。
三、適用人群與閱讀建議
本書定位明確,非常適合以下讀者:
- 高等院校計算機相關專業的學生:可作為“Web開發”或“移動應用開發”課程的教材,知識體系與高校教學大綱貼合。
- 希望轉型或拓寬技能棧的開發者:例如Web開發者想入門移動端,或Android開發者想了解后端邏輯,本書提供了高效的入門途徑。
- 自學者:語言通俗,步驟詳細,只要具備基本的編程概念(如了解C/Java更佳),即可跟隨學習。
建議讀者在學習時,務必動手實踐每一個例子,并嘗試對項目進行拓展和修改。由于技術更新較快,書中涉及的某些工具版本可能已有更新,讀者應學會舉一反三,掌握核心原理,并善于利用官方文檔解決版本差異問題。
四、書評與在線閱讀體驗
從各大圖書平臺的評價來看,本書普遍獲得了初學者的好評。讀者認為其講解細致、案例實用,尤其是將PHP與Android結合的思路很有價值。部分讀者指出,作為入門教材,其深度可能無法滿足高級開發者的需求,但這恰恰符合其“入門與實踐”的定位。
關于在線閱讀,在當當等圖書平臺通常提供有詳細的目錄試讀和部分章節內容預覽。這有助于購買前了解其寫作風格和內容深度。建議通過試讀判斷是否與自己的學習節奏匹配。
###
《PHP Web和Android開發入門與實踐》是一本優秀的綜合性入門教材。它像一座橋梁,連接了Web與移動兩大開發領域。通過系統學習,讀者不僅能掌握PHP和Android兩項熱門技能,更能理解全棧開發的思維模式。在信息技術教育強調應用能力培養的當下,這樣一本注重實戰、體系完整的教材,無疑是學習者踏上開發之路的一位可靠向導。